Description

SonicWall Global VPN Client version 4.10.8.1108 and earlier is vulnerable to an out-of-bounds kernel memory read in the SWIPsec.sys driver, which could allow a local attacker to cause a system crash.

Executive Summary

SonicWall Global VPN Client version 4.10.8.1108 and earlier has a flaw in the SWIPsec.sys driver where an out-of-bounds kernel memory read can occur. This vulnerability allows a local attacker to potentially cause a system crash by exploiting this memory read issue.

Impact Analysis

This vulnerability could allow a local attacker to crash your system by triggering the out-of-bounds memory read in the SWIPsec.sys driver. This may lead to denial-of-service conditions, disrupting your ability to use the VPN client and potentially causing data loss or system instability.
